
Shultz Energy Fellowships (formerly Stanford Energy Internships in California and the West)
State-level efforts are essential in our fight against climate change, especially in the field of energy. Stanford University is committed to helping by integrating its students into the local energy and climate ecosystem through this energy-related summer internship program for undergraduate and graduate students.
SEICW offers a suite of paid, energy-related public service internships for Stanford students in California, Colorado, Utah, and Hawaii during the summer.
